Basilcello, Basil Liqueur-Liquor Recipe
October 23rd, 2007 · 24 Comments
Also known as Liquore al Basilico, this herb-infused alcohol (liquor or liqueur, as you prefer) is very similar to its more popular cousin, Limoncello. The basic steps and method are the same for making it.

Pane, Amore and Insanita’?
October 19th, 2007 · 24 Comments
This is a new campaign by the Ministero della Salute (Ministry of Health) here in Italy.
The wording roughly translates to, “Food, Love, and Health” - the 3 basic ingredients for a happy life, according to the government.
